Revolutionizing Communication and Connection
The internet has revolutionized the way we communicate and connect with others. It has broken down geographical barriers and allowed us to interact with people from all corners of the world. Social media platforms, in particular, have made it easier than ever to share our thoughts, ideas, and experiences with a global audience.

The Ease of Information Access
Another significant benefit of the internet is the ease of access to information. We have a wealth of knowledge at our fingertips, enabling us to learn and grow in ways that were previously unimaginable. This has not only enhanced my blogging but also enriched my personal and professional life.
